Honey Stinger Organic Gels Review
Energy availability
The energy took a little bit longer to quick in when compared to other gels (about 4 minutes longer)
Energy duration (30-minute test)
This gel hit the mark with keeping my energy level up for the 30-minute test. I was able to mentally focus without any cloudiness. Once the energy kicked in it sustained me for close to the 30-minute mark. No dragging whatsoever.
Availability
Most running stores and big chain grocery stores carry these gels. Also abundantly available online, although Amazon was sold out of quite a few of them. Flavors Tested
- Gold (not organic) – tasted like gelled honey and water mixed together. No aftertaste. If you love honey and don’t mind the non-organic ingredients then this one is for you. No stomach Issues.
- Fruit Smoothie (organic) – The taste was on the strawberry side of a fruit smoothie. You can definitely taste the honey but not overwhelming. The one drawback it had was it left a little bit of an aftertaste that lasted my entire run. The consistency of the gel was thick and well blended. The honey stinger fruit smoothie was slightly sweeter than I like my gels, but if I had to use these in training or a race I could make due. No stomach Issues.

Nutritional Facts
- Serving size: 31 g
- Calories: 100
- Sodium: 50 mg
- Calcium: 0 mg
- Total Carbs: 24 g
- Total Sugars: 10 g (includes 10 g added sugar)
- Vegan: No
- Gluten-free: No
- Organic: Yes
- Take with water: Yes
- Caffeine: 0 mg
Ingredients
- Organic tapioca syrup
- Organic honey
- Water
- Potassium citrate
- Natural flavor
- Citric acid
- Salt
